Here's the issue. This may be a bit long, but important to understand. When people say "New" Metallica way too often they don't grasp that time has marched on. The real issue they have is with 90s-early 00s Metallica. For some after The Black Album and for others including The Black Album. However, it's NOT just Metallica. In the 90s "Metal" was considered dead and obsolete with Grunge and Alternative and even Industrial being in it's place. This is in large part due to most people of the time not knowing anything about Metal other than the Glam Hair Metal scene of the 80s. Metal bands weren't getting the crazy success they had in the 80s and drastically changed their look and sound and more importantly in many cases their spirit for monetary gain and fame in what ended up being a fad long term. The bands who didn't change their look and sound this way and stayed true to themselves attained godlike status forevermore afterward and considered "true" metal for never once compromising their artistic vision. Examples include but are not limited to: Slayer, Danzig, Dio, King Diamond, Overkill. It also allowed the newer or breaking through to the mainstream bands like European bands such as In Flames and At The Gates to change where Metalheads were primarily getting their Metal fix from and American bands like Pantera to become the epitome of Metal itself by flying the flag of going against music trends of the times unlike many of their contemporaries and heroes like Metallica. Metallica's two Load albums were as far away as you could get from Pantera albums like Far Beyond Driven and The Great Southern Trendkill let alone Norwegian black metal bands like Burzum and Immortal. Then everything that came afterward like Amon Amarth and Dragonforce. Then they did an album with a full on Orchestra that in terms of being "Metal" is like what you'd imagine a Metallica album to sound like if it was made my Disney. It just felt sanitized and family friendly. To Metal what America's Funniest Home Videos with Bob Saget was to Comedy. Then Saint Anger with a snare drum you should only hear in the 9th circle of Hell. For many who tolerated Metallica's new direction hoping for something decent St. Anger was just the nail in the coffin and most never looked back. And to be fair with the Metal landscape world wide changing as much as it did they really didn't have a reason to. St. Anger was such a low point it lit a fire under Metallica's ass and really started turning things around with albums like Death Magnetic and Hardwired that has won over many fans who had walked away with killer tracks like this one. However many REFUSE to give it a try from being burned in the past too many times (can you really blame them?) and others who moved on just never heard stuff like this. For the record I actually like The Black Album, most of the two Load Albums, if I'm in the right mood I can listen to the Orchestra album, and like the song Saint Anger despite the god awful snare (and I'm a drummer so it's 10 times more painful for me) but the rest of that album can burn in a fire. I only wrote all that in fairness to those with a problem with Metallica past the 80s to accurately reflect their position and where it's coming from instead of just dismissing them as stupid assholes who don't have arguments and reasons why they have the opinions that they do when that is absolutely not the case. I mean, (I know I'm beating a dead horse here) imagine you're a Metalhead in 2003. You're in a music store, you can only buy ONE album and you see the following new choices: Metallica - St. Anger, King Diamond - The Puppet Master, Stratovarious - Elements pt1, Black Label Society - The Blessed Hellride, Type O Negative - Life is Killing Me, Dimmu Borgir - Death Cult Armageddon, and Opeth - Damnation among others. Are you REALLY walking out of the store with Metallica? People give Metallica haters shit, and I'm not saying it's entirely undeserved, but no one ever looks at the time period and realizes the obvious idea that there were just better choices because Metallica weren't trying to appeal to the Metal crowd but rather the Top 40 radio/mid-late 90s MTV crowd and it showed. That's why there was the backlash that persists to this day.
